Transaction dc2075a0ec3eb29c3e82f079be721187d0b550c577a83b098d15e4895ff1cc6a
1 Input
1 Outputs
- dc2075a0ec3eb29c3e82f079be721187d0b550c577a83b098d15e4895ff1cc6a:0
value 154370
address 331uPEhKTrjYkJTaMm5RFDw1qoFuuPi6UY